High-impedance amplifier for a novel 14 cm short AM/FM automotive active antenna

2010 
The design of an ultra short capacitive coupled helical AM/FM active automotive antenna with a length of only 14 cm (5.6") is investigated and its performance is presented. The antenna element produces very sharp resonances and is therefore difficult to use for broadband radio reception. The proposed high impedance amplifier concept flattens the frequency response of the very short resonant antenna, while maintaining a low noise level and a good linearity. The design has been realized and the measurements show that the new 14 cm active antenna has comparable sensitivity with 40 cm (15.8") long active monopole antennas. Field measurements indicate good performance in comparison to common passive rod antennas of 90 cm (35.4") length, both in AM and FM range.
